What they do

A Receptionist greets and directs customers or visitors that come in to an office or business, and answers and directs incoming phone calls. Deals with mail or courier services. May schedule appointments or meeting rooms, gather patient information, or assist with filing or other administrative support work.

Responsibilities:
Guest services - Welcome guests, employees, and clients who arrive at the office and clarify the purpose of their visit and who they want to see. Answer all phone calls and emails sent to the main office and provide inter-office messages as requested. Administration - Send out and receive mail, documents, supplies and packages. Distribute items to mailboxes and offices as requested. File and keep good records. Maintain office supplies and reorder as needed. Maintain an organized filing system. Manage a schedule for those needing support and schedule appointments as required.
